Flood Warning
What: Urban areas and small streams flooding caused by excessive rainfall is expected.
Where: Northeastern Calumet County in east central Wisconsin Northern Manitowoc County in east central Wisconsin Brown County in northeastern Wisconsin Kewaunee County in northeastern Wisconsin Northeastern Outagamie County in northeastern Wisconsin
When: Until 700 PM CDT Tuesday.
Impacts: Numerous roads remain closed due to flooding. Streams continue to rise due to excess runoff from earlier rainfall.
Additional Details: - At 947 AM CDT, local law enforcement reported numerous roads remain closed due to heavy rain and flooding from last night. - Some locations that will experience flooding include Green Bay, Kewaunee, Kaukauna, Little Chute, Algoma, Luxemburg, Denmark, Black Creek, Two Creeks, Bellevue, Oneida, De Pere, Howard, Ashwaubenon, Allouez, Two Rivers, Ledgeview and Hobart. - http://www.weather.gov/safety/flood
Turn around, don't dr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ood deaths occur in vehicles. Be aware of your surroundings and do not drive on flooded roads.
